Man City Get Two Thirds Of The Tips On OLBG To Beat Man Utd In FA Cup
Friday 06 January 2012 at 10:10
The highlight of the FA Cup Third Round this weekend is undoubtedly Man City v Man Utd, a game in which fierce rivals and the top two teams in the country at the moment go head to head. The OLBG tipsters seem to be siding with the home side to win this game currently and whichever outcome you back it seems you’ll get good odds in such a tough match.
Majority Of Tipsters Backing Man City For FA Cup Triumph
At the time of writing 68.2% of tips on the outcome of this match on OLBG have been for a home win at odds of 6/5 with William Hill. One of the OLBG tipsters who has gone for Man City to knock their rivals out of the FA Cup is Derby fan iamwinning:
“I can only see Man City winning here, having won so many on the trot at home. Man Utd have just lost 2 in a row (Blackburn and Newcastle) and I can't see them coming close at the Etihad on Sunday!”
The 6-1 victory for Man City at Old Trafford earlier in the season is clearly going to be influencing people’s bets for this match, especially with City now enjoying home advantage for this match and it is perhaps a surprise to see City available at odds against for this match.
Man Utd Require Huge Turnaround To Win At Eastlands
Bizarrely no one had tipped the draw at 12/5 with Bet365 in this match at the time of writing which means the remaining 31.8% of tips in the OLBG Tipster Competition have gone on Man Utd gaining revenge for the big loss they suffered against Man City this season. One of the OLBG Tipsters who has backed Man Utd is Lanzarote666:
“I cannot help but be influenced by the Bolton vs Stoke match earlier this season to find a winner in Manchester. Bolton were hammered 5-0 by Stoke on 17 April in the FA Cup Semi final, and then played a home match against Stoke on 6 November. Bolton were in terrible form, expected to lose, but went on to gain revenge by winning 5-0. Players seem to have a strong desire to put right earlier humiliations. ManU seem in a similar position having lost two and up against City's home record, but with the Toures missing out in Africa, I am keen to back that the Reds will be motivated to turn around that earlier season result. So ManU 6-1 then? Tough ask!”
